Piero Lerda Artist - Torino, Italy 10 years ago Follow Don’t follow 6178 493 Comments 45015 Visits Share Facebook Twitter Google + marta fumagalli Artist - Milano, Italy 16 years ago Follow Don’t follow 29 4 Comments 1113 Visits Share Facebook Twitter Google +